Snacks and Skills: Teaching Children Functional Counting Skills.
Xin, Joy F.; Holmdal, Pamela
TEACHING Exceptional Children, v35 n5 p46-51 May-Jun 2003
This article describes how two young children with moderate/severe mental retardation were taught functional counting skills by helping with a snack delivery activity. Instruction involved a task analysis, use of pictures to represent objects and numbers, self-monitoring to increase student independence, and ongoing evaluation. The importance of such functional skills for students with severe disabilities is stressed. (Contains references.) (DB)
